Biography
Todoraki Peshov (Bulgarian: Тодораки Пешов) (5 April 1838, Zhelyava – 1892, Sofia) was a Bulgarian politician and merchant. After the Liberation of Bulgaria from Ottoman rule in 1878 he became the first elected Mayor of Sofia, which was soon proclaimed capital of the re-established Bulgarian state.
